Park Overview

Gadsdenboro Park is a 5-acre public green space situated in Charleston, South Carolina. Formerly known as Concord Park, it is centrally located between Calhoun, Concord, Laurens, and Washington streets, making it easily accessible for both residents and visitors.

The park has been designed with a nautical theme, reflecting its proximity to the Charleston Maritime Center and the nearby South Carolina Aquarium. A significant renovation was completed in 2015, transforming it into a vibrant area for recreation and relaxation at a cost of $5.7 million.

Natural Features

Visitors to Gadsdenboro Park will find it a serene oasis amidst the bustling city. The landscape is enriched by over 100 trees, which provide shade and enhance the park's aesthetic appeal.

An ornate fountain featuring a sculpture of birds taking flight serves as a visual centerpiece within the park, providing an attractive spot for visitors to gather and relax.

Recreational Facilities

One of the central features of the park is its sports fields, which are suitable for soccer and other outdoor activities. In addition to sports facilities, the park offers paved walking paths that encourage leisurely strolls and cycling.

The park also includes various amenities such as game tables, a bocce court, and public restrooms. The combination of recreational and relaxation spaces makes it an ideal spot for individuals, families, and groups looking to enjoy the outdoors in a beautiful setting.

Children's Play Areas

The two custom-designed playgrounds cater to different age groups, making the park a family-friendly destination. The playgrounds include a tugboat structure for younger children, accompanied by nautical-themed elements that encourage imaginative play.

For older children, there is a larger ship structure equipped with taller slides and more adventurous climbing features.
